地址是区块链和加密货币生态系统中的一个基本组成部分,代表了数字资产的目的地或来源点。在加密货币网络中,地址通常是由公钥通过单向哈希函数和其他加密算法派生出的字符串。它的核心作用是安全地接收加密资产,同时避免暴露用户的私钥。地址使交易参与者能够在不泄露敏感信息的情况下进行价值转移,成为区块链系统隐私和安全架构的重要组成部分。
地址的起源可追溯至中本聪创立比特币时所设计的密码学基础设施。为了实现电子现金系统中的所有权证明和转移,比特币引入了基于公钥密码学的地址系统。这种系统避免了传统金融体系中依赖可信第三方的需求,转而使用密码学方法来验证资产所有权。随着时间推移,地址格式在不同区块链项目中有所演变,从比特币的P2PKH地址,到以太坊的十六进制格式,再到更新的多功能地址类型。
地址的工作机制建立在非对称加密的基础上。首先,通过特定算法生成私钥和对应的公钥。然后,将公钥通过单向散列函数(如SHA-256和RIPEMD-160)进行处理,添加版本前缀并使用校验和,最终转换为用户可读的格式(如Base58Check编码)。这个过程保证了地址的唯一性和安全性。不同区块链采用不同的地址生成算法和格式,例如比特币使用以"1"、"3"或"bc1"开头的地址,而以太坊地址则以"0x"开头。重要的是,虽然地址源自公钥,但其单向转换特性意味着无法从地址反向推导出原始公钥,进一步增强了系统安全性。
虽然加密货币地址在设计上具有安全性,但仍存在多种风险和挑战。人为错误是一大风险因素——由于地址通常是长字符串,复制粘贴错误可能导致资产永久丢失。社会工程学攻击,如网络钓鱼和地址替换恶意软件,也是常见的安全威胁。技术方面的风险包括量子计算潜在挑战现有密码学基础的可能性,以及不同区块链间地址格式不兼容引发的资产误发送问题。此外,地址的匿名性和可追踪性之间的平衡也带来了隐私与合规的双重挑战,监管机构正在寻求方法来增强地址透明度,同时区块链项目则努力提供更好的隐私保护功能。
加密货币地址作为区块链技术的核心组件,为数字价值转移提供了安全、高效的机制。它们不仅支持了点对点交易的基本功能,还影响了整个加密货币生态系统的安全模型、隐私特性和用户体验。随着技术发展,地址系统也在不断演进,寻求更好地平衡可用性、安全性和隐私保护。从单一功能的接收点,到支持智能合约交互的多功能接口,地址的概念和应用正在扩展,在区块链技术的未来发展中继续扮演关键角色。
分享